Skip to content

Latest commit

 

History

History
34 lines (25 loc) · 863 Bytes

README.md

File metadata and controls

34 lines (25 loc) · 863 Bytes

bert-squad-demo

Demo web server app that shows how BERT model trained on SQuAD dataset deals with the machine comprehension task.

It was implemented for the purposes of presentation on STX Next Tech Power Summit 2019. Slides from the presentation are available here.

Quick guide

Before running the app, please make sure that you have all requirements installed and download BERT model for machine comprehension.

To run the server, navigate into the main project's directory and type

$ flask run

Requests sent to the BERT web server should have the following form:

{
  "context": "Bert is a yellow Muppet character...",
  "question": "Who was the first Bert performer?"
}  

You can expect answers of the form:

{
    "answer": "Frank Oz"
}